Active Adventure: Hike to small villages, nestled among temples and monasteries in the beautiful countryside. Bike up the curving road to Haa Valley or ride up in the support car and then enjoy a downhill bike cruise. Take an easy raft on a Class 2/3 river through lush Punakha valley or spend the afternoon relaxing in a safari tent camp. Throughout the trip, you will have spectacular views of steep sided valleys and occasional panoramas of snow capped peaks reaching nearly 25,000 ft.
Vibrant Culture: Attend an ornate mask dance festival where monks of Bumthang Valley purify the area of evil spirits and local people dress in their finest clothing for the event. Monastery tours in Thimphu and other towns reveal splendid painting and sculpture and an inside look at monastic life. Witness archery competitions and traditional weaving of Bhutan’s famously complex textiles.
